
Ephesians 5:18 ‘Do Not Get Drunk With Wine’ Explained
Is this a threat to those that drink? Why does it come up in Ephesians 5:18? Today we see this is really about a contrast between your OLD identity and your new one.
It’s not okay to be a drunkard or a stumbling block. But we need to understand the context and not redefine the writer’s intention.
